Manufacturing Supplier Quality Engineer
We are looking for a Supplier Quality Engineer to join the Manufacturing Department at our Foster City headquarter. This position reports to Director, Manufacturing Quality.
Responsibilities:
Develops, evaluates, revises, and applies technical quality assurance protocols/methods to inspect and test in-process raw materials, production equipment, and finished products. Ensures activities and items are in compliance with both company quality assurance standards and applicable government regulations. Performs analysis and identifies trends in the inspection of finished products, in-process materials and bulk raw materials, and recommends corrective actions when necessary. Ensures that established manufacturing inspection, sampling and statistical process control procedures are followed. May assure compliance to in-house and/or external specifications and standards, such as ANSI and IPC regulations. Evaluates and analyzes the efforts in organizing, documenting, and interpreting inspection support documents and records. Ensures that suppliers deliver quality parts, materials, and services. Qualifies suppliers according to company standards and may administer a Certified Supplier Program in receiving inspection to ensure cost effectiveness. Monitors parts from acquisition through the manufacturing cycle and communicates and resolves supplier-related problems as they occur. Develops QA Plans for new products and provides DFM and DFQ input at preproduction design reviews. Reviews 6 Sigma, Lean, JIT, Kanban, SPC, TQM, and other classic quality programs that may be used internally at CM, PCBA, plastic, sheet metal, power supply, drive, cable, packaging, furniture, media pack, and other sub-assembly and component suppliers. Performs first article, prototype, and out-of-box quality audits at local and remote suppliers and maintains quality metrics based on results to continuously measure supplier performance and qualification status.Prepares yield and defect pareto charts from factory and RMA data for periodic review by OEM and upper management and for weekly continuous improvement process meetings with contract manufacturers.Analyzes and repairs DOA field returns and provides problem resolution reports to affected customers.
